The University of Winchester is seeking a dedicated Audio Visual and Classroom Technician to enhance our technology-enabled teaching and learning spaces. In this role, you will contribute to the design, installation, and maintenance of AV solutions, ensuring functionality and an inspiring learning environment.

You’ll work closely with team members and third-party providers to deliver solutions that meet high standards for our teaching spaces. Working in our Technology for Teaching Team (TFT), you will be assisting with all aspects of audio-visual equipment, from maintenance, installation and demonstration to answering queries from staff and students.

TFT is one of the key groups in the department and your role is pivotal in making the learning experience for students, staff and external customers as good as possible.

As our ideal candidate you will have knowledge of audio-visual equipment, together with good technical workshop skills and customer service experience. Familiarity with current standards for AV setups and interest in emerging technologies like augmented and virtual spaces is essential. Working knowledge of audio-visual control solutions using Crestron, MS365, using digital signage systems and audio over IP would be an advantage but full training is provided.
